Who are Cyberagent Legit?
Cyberagent Legit is a professional Japanese dance group.
The group performed a choreography to their own original music.
Their performance includes robotic dancing, acrobatics and breakdancing.
How old are the members of Cyberagent Legit?
The members of Cyberagent Legit are between 20 and 28 years old.
The group has eight members.

When did Cyberagent Legit perform on Britain’s Got Talent?

6
Cyberagent Legit performed on Saturday April 27, 2024 on Britain’s Got Talent.
However the show was prerecorded in January 2024 in London.
They got standing ovations from the judges.
Simon Cowell pressed the golden buzzer for them and said: “Amazing! That was fantastic, that was my favourite act of the day actually.
“Really, really, really good.
“This is the kind of act you want in a competition, it was really so good.
“And I could see how much time had gone into that, everyone in this theatre was rooting for you.”
A member of the group said about receiving the golden buzzer: “This is a dream come true for us.”
